Understanding disaster cleanup processes is crucial for each people and communities affected by numerous types of disasters. Whether the disaster arises from pure occasions similar to floods, hurricanes, or earthquakes, or from man-made incidents like industrial accidents, the ensuing cleanup requires a systematic approach that encompasses security, organization, and thoroughness.
The initial steps in disaster cleanup usually involve assessing the situation to establish the extent of the damage. This requires a careful evaluation of each physical conditions and potential hazards. First responders, together with firefighters and emergency medical personnel, might often be the primary to navigate by way of the chaos, making certain that the area is secure for subsequent cleanup efforts. Their expertise is crucial in identifying structural hazards, chemical spills, or electrical risks present within the surroundings.

Once the realm is deemed safe, the following section entails a coordinated effort typically led by local authorities. Community organizations, non-profits, and varied authorities businesses collaborate to mobilize resources and personnel. This collaboration fosters a sense of unity and shared accountability amongst residents, reinforcing the significance of group resilience. Volunteers typically play an essential function, bringing enthusiasm and manpower to the restoration effort.

The cleanup process encompasses quite a lot of duties, together with debris removal, sanitation, and restoration. Each task requires a singular set of expertise and tools. For occasion, particles removal usually necessitates heavy equipment like bulldozers and dump vans, which can effectively clear giant areas of fallen timber, wreckage, and different obstacles. This stage may contain sorting recyclable supplies to minimize environmental influence.


In distinction, sanitation is a critical element that cannot be missed. Floodwaters, for example, can introduce dangerous micro organism and pathogens into homes and public spaces. Professionals in disaster cleanup usually make use of specialized techniques to disinfect surfaces and be certain that residing spaces are secure for inhabitants. The use of industrial-grade cleaners and tools is commonplace in this part, highlighting the necessity for trained personnel to handle these materials effectively.

Communication performs a vital function throughout the disaster cleanup process. Coordination amongst various stakeholders, together with governmental companies, nonprofits, and volunteers, ensures that efforts are not duplicated and assets are optimally utilized. Effective communication additionally involves maintaining the public knowledgeable about security measures, particles pickup schedules, and obtainable aid sources, which can alleviate fears and supply clear steering.




During cleanup, mental health should not be ignored. Experiencing a disaster may be traumatic, resulting in emotional distress for these affected. Counseling services for restoration typically turn into an integral a part of the cleanup efforts, providing the original source essential psychological support to people who have lost their homes, family members, or communities. Recognizing the emotional toll is as very important as physical cleanup, ensuring that restoration is holistic.

How lengthy does a typical disaster cleanup take?undefinedThe period can vary tremendously relying on the severity of the disaster, the scale of the world affected, and the resources obtainable. It can take anywhere from days to a quantity of weeks or months for complete restoration.


Should I contact my insurance company earlier than cleanup?undefinedYes, it’s wise to contact your insurance firm as soon as potential to report the damage. This ensures you understand your protection and can begin documenting the damage for claims.

How do I prevent further damage during cleanup?undefinedTo prevent further damage, management the water supply if applicable, remove wet objects to advertise drying, and begin cleaning areas instantly whereas making certain you are safe and following correct protocols.


What are the indicators of mold progress after a disaster?undefinedSigns include seen mold patches, a musty odor, or areas of water damage that persist after the preliminary cleanup. Mold can develop quickly, so it’s necessary to handle moisture issues as soon as attainable.
